MBIN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review

174 of the 6,925 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Merchants Bancorp (MBIN)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$589M — up 14% from $516M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 21 funds opened new MBIN positions and 19 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 88 added to existing stakes and 40 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Marshall Wace, adding an estimated $14.8M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$5.56M.
